As previously mentioned, mainlineFinal Fantasygames tend to take a long time to develop. In fact, the most recent non-remake entry,Final Fantasy 15, took approximately ten years to develop before finally being released. However, this trend of long periods of development time does not appear to be the case withFinal Fantasy 16.

Back in late August, it was discovered thatan official Twitter account forFinal Fantasy 16was created, which led many fans to believe that an announcement was inevitable. Ultimately, no other proof was presented to further corroborate this theory. Until a certain influential developer made an interesting retweet.
Shinji Hashimoto is a member of Square Enix and serves as the current Brand Manager forFinal Fantasyas a whole. Earlier today, Hashimoto retweeted announcements ofthe upcoming PS5 showcase happening later in September. According to fans, Hashimoto typically doesn’t do this unless he is directly related to some big project, which could indicate that somethingFinal Fantasyrelated could be shown off during the showcase.
Having said all this, it is important to note that not only is all of this mere speculation at this time, but also consider that just because a new mainlineFinal Fantasygame is announced, doesn’t necessarily mean it will release in a timely manner.Final Fantasy 7 Remakewas announced back in 2015 after many years of development and was delayed again and again before finally releasing back in April of this year. Thus, even ifFinal Fantasy 16is announced, that doesn’t guarantee a swift release date.
